Summary:
The book is a collection of humorous essays and observations from the author's life, covering her childhood, career in comedy, and experiences in Hollywood. It offers a candid and witty look at her personal insecurities, relationships, and the challenges of being a woman in the entertainment industry.
Key points:
1. Self-Love: Kaling promotes self-acceptance and embracing uniqueness, encouraging readers to resist societal pressures.
